Why Choosing the Right Credit Card for Hotel Booking Matters?

At first, you might be wondering: what’s so important about using the “right” credit card to book hotels? What does the “right” credit card even mean? 


While there’s no “one-size-fits-all” credit card that applies to everyone’s spending needs and patterns, using recommended credit cards for specific expenses makes the biggest difference. To put simply, it’s all about strategising your payments with the best credit card that maximises rewards, miles, or cashback for each type of expense.


For example, using a cashback credit card (e.g. UOB One Card) for everyday transactions such as groceries and public transport is an effective way to maximise cashback effortlessly. Meanwhile, capitalising on travel credit cards (e.g. KrisFlyer UOB Card) for booking flights and hotel stays earns you more miles and grants access to greater travel benefits. If you prefer flexibility, a rewards credit card (e.g. Citi Rewards Card) offers the option to convert rewards points into miles or other rewards for redemption.


With the right credit card, the world is truly your oyster when it comes to travel!

Key Features to Look For in Best Hotel Booking Credit Cards

Now, let’s examine some hallmarks of what makes a good credit card for hotel booking.

Exclusive Hotel Perks & Hotel Loyalty Programmes

Miles and dedicated travel credit cards often come with special hotel benefits for customers. This includes perks like room upgrades, early check-ins, late check-outs, complimentary breakfast, automatic elite membership status with prestigious hotel chains, and more.

For example, while the AMEX Platinum Charge Card comes with a hefty $1,744 annual fee commitment, in return, it grants elite status across multiple hotel and car rental loyalty programmes:
  • Avis President’s Club
  • Hertz Gold Plus Rewards Five Star
  • Hilton Honors Gold
  • Marriott Bonvoy Gold
  • Radisson Rewards Platinum
  • Pan Pacific DISCOVERY Platinum


  • Among these, the Hilton Honors Gold stands out as the most valuable, offering complimentary breakfast for two, which can result in substantial savings in premium destinations especially. Besides that, Hilton Gold members get to enjoy the 5th night free on reward stays booked with all points, alongside 10,000 bonus points for every 10 nights stayed within a calendar year (from 40 nights onwards).
    While other membership programmes provide room upgrades and late check-out privileges, their benefits are comparatively limited. Nevertheless, possessing elite status for any hotel loyalty programme is already a notable flex. 🏆🏨

    Bonus Rewards on Hotel Stays

    Certain credit cards are specifically designed to reward hotel bookings via higher bonus miles, points, or cashback rates. Travel credit cards like the Citi PremierMiles Card does an amazing job at this—featuring 10 Citi Miles per $1 spend (mpd) on hotel bookings via Kaligo and 7.2 Citi mpd on hotel bookings worldwide via Agoda.

    Bonus Miles Earn Rate (Local & Overseas Spend)

    Along the same vein, travel credit cards shine in earning bonus miles on both local and foreign currency expenses. Popular choices include the HSBC TravelOne Card and the Standard Chartered Journey Card. The former nets 2.4 mpd on foreign currency spend and 1.2 mpd on local spend, while the latter rewards 2 miles on foreign currency spend, 1.2 mpd on local spend, and even a special 3 mpd rate on select local everyday transactions.

    These credit cards are ideal for straightforward and hassle-free spending, catering to those against over-complicated credit card strategies and prefer consolidating their spending onto a single card.

    Complimentary Travel Insurance

    Many credit cards offer complimentary travel insurance coverage when you charge your full travel fare to the card. Typically ranging between S$350,000 to S$1 million, coverage benefits cover components like overseas medical expenses, accidental death and permanent disablement, travel delays and cancellations, and baggage damage and loss. Of course, the full scope varies across travel insurance providers.

    For example, the UOB PRVI Miles Visa Card provides up to S$500,000 coverage for accidental death and permanent disablement, whereas the CIMB Visa Infinite Card offers a higher coverage of up to S$1 million.

    No Foreign Transaction Fees

    To ease travelling woes, miles and travel credit cards tend to waive foreign transaction fees. Credit card foreign transaction fees are surcharges imposed by banks on transactions processed in foreign currency or spent overseas—covering currency conversion and other costs.

    For Singapore credit cards, such charges usually comprise a bank administrative fee (2.25% – 2.5%) and a card issuer fee (1% from Visa/Mastercard/AMEX), totalling up to 3.5%. Needless to say, an additional 3.25% to 3.5% surcharge on every overseas transaction adds up, especially for noticeable expenses like hotel bookings!

    Note: This is not to be confused with Dynamic Currency Conversion (DCC) fee, which is the 1% currency conversion charge imposed when paying in SGD while overseas.

    How to Maximise Rewards With the Best Hotel Credit Cards?

    Stay at Properties with “Higher Earning Potential” 🪙


    Higher-tier luxury hotel chains tend to offer more loyalty points per dollar spent. For instance, the Ritz-Carlton under Marriott Bonvoy offers 10 points per US$1 spend together with 1 Elite Nite Credit per night.

    Combine Credit Card + Hotel Bonus Promotions 🏨


    Stacking ongoing hotel promotions on top of your credit card rewards is another great strategy to maximise points on all fronts. Currently, the Hilton Honors rewards double points on all eligible hotel stays until 30 April 2025. Assuming you charge your hotel stay to a UOB Lady’s Card, that’s 4 mpd in addition to double Hilton loyalty points.

    Use Co-Branded Credit Cards 💳


    Co-branded credit cards like the KrisFlyer UOB Card and AMEX Singapore Airlines KrisFlyer Card are popular among frequent flyers. Since both cards are directly partnered with Singapore Airlines, they automatically earn KrisFlyer miles on eligible purchases—eliminating the hassle of manually converting credit card points into airline miles.

    Pool or Transfer Credit Card Points to Airline Partners ✈️


    Besides co-branded cards, credit cards from the same bank tend to let cardholders pool rewards points across several cards before transferring them into frequent flyer miles. For example, both the DBS Vantage Card and DBS Altitude Card earn 2.2 mpd on foreign currency spend, in which these DBS Points can be aggregated and transferred to airline and/or hotel loyalty programmes.

    Elite Status Membership Perks 🏆


    As mentioned above, multiple miles credit cards grant elite status membership to their cardholders. For example, the AMEX Singapore Airlines KrisFlyer Ascend Card grants Hilton Honors Silver status, featuring hotel benefits like late check-out, free extra night’s stay, and bonus loyalty points.

    Book Directly With Hotels 🛎️


    Contrary to popular belief, booking directly with hotels can be more cost-effective than online travel agencies (OTA). Most hotel loyalty programmes do not award points or elite night credits for OTA bookings, and elite members will miss out on their usual hotel perks like free breakfast, room upgrades, and delayed check-outs.

    Hotels also tend to offer best rate guarantees, matching OTA prices and providing member-exclusive rates too.

    Lastly, direct hotel bookings mean more flexible cancellations and change policies, unlike stricter OTA penalties and non-refundable rates.

    How to Choose the Best Credit Card For Your Travel Needs?

    Choosing the right credit card to save you money and enhance your travel experience can really make or break the trip. But not all credit cards are created equal—what works for a casual traveller may not suit a frequent flyer.

    A card with no or minimum annual fee will be the most cost-effective since you won’t use this card often enough to justify paying such a high fee.

    If you’re a casual traveller

    For occasional travellers—whether it’s for business or leisure—you’ll want a credit card that offers decent travel perks and flexibility for minimal costs. Look for cards that offer:

  • Low or no annual fees. Avoid unnecessary costs since you’re travelling infrequently.
  • Decent travel rewards and cashback. Earn cashback or points on flights, hotels, and everyday spending.
  • Basic travel insurance coverage. Compare your card’s coverage with single-trip insurance.
  • Occasional airport lounge access. Some credit cards offer a few free airport lounge visits per year.
  • If you’re a frequent flyer

    On the other hand, if you’re a self-proclaimed jetsetter and aspire to travel the world in 90 days (we’re joking), choosing the right travel credit card can make all the difference in your frequent adventures. Here’s what you should consider:

  • No foreign transaction fees. Avoid costly currency conversion charges.
  • High bonus miles earn rate. Make your local and overseas expenses work smarter and harder for you.
  • Airline loyalty and transfer partners. Let your accumulated mileage naturally redeem airline and hotel perks for you.
  • Priority boarding and additional or free baggage check. Enjoy early access and baggage savings.
  • Premium travel insurance coverage. You might want to consider annual travel insurance for better value and coverage overall.
  • Complimentary fast-track to elite hotel status.
  • Luxury airport and hotel concierge services.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    Can you use credit card points for hotels?

    Yes, many credit card rewards points may be redeemed for hotel stays through hotel loyalty programmes, credit card travel portals, and more.

    How many points do you need to redeem to stay in a hotel?

    It depends and differs across hotel loyalty programmes.

    For example, you’ll need to redeem at least 5,000 IHG points to use Points & Cash or redeem a Reward Night at IHG hotels.

    Do hotels charge credit cards when checking in?

    Sometimes, hotels may require a credit card at the time of booking, but only charge it a few days prior to your reservation.

    Alternatively, upon check-in, the hotel may place a hold on card for the duration of your stay.

    Which credit card is best to use for hotel booking?

    There’s no “single” best credit card for hotel bookings. A card’s suitability depends on factors like the booking platform, your travel preferences, and the rewards or perks you value the most.
